History tried to hide them, so they staged a spectacle.

Inspired by true events, The Gorgeous Nothings uncovers the long-buried story of the “Fag Ward,” a hidden wing of the Men’s Penitentiary on Welfare Island in New York City, where inmates were imprisoned in the 1930s for homosexuality. With a score drawn from the Great American Songbook, this world premiere musical weaves six inmates’ stories into high-camp numbers from the ward’s annual Christmas pageant to expose a secret, fabulous, world that was never supposed to have existed.

Accessibility

  • Assisted Listening System

    Infrared assistive listening systems are installed in all theaters and headsets may be used at any seat. Headsets with induction neckloops are available for patrons who use hearing aids and cochlear implants with a “T” switch. Devices are distributed free-of-charge on a first-come, first-served basis. Devices are available at the Ticketing and Information Desk. Please request a device from staff as you arrive.
  • Box Office

    The Ticketing and Information Desk, located in the lobby entrance, is accessible.
  • Elevator/Escalator

    Accessible Ramps and Elevators allow patrons to reach all levels/areas of PAC NYC. Elevators are provided to navigate from the ground level to the main foyer and restaurant and to all levels of the theaters where accessible seating is present.
  • Entrance

    An accessible entrance/elevator is available at the main entrance to PAC NYC. All theaters, the restaurant and Ticketing and Information Desk are accessible.
  • Folding Armrests

    Seats with removable armrests are available in all venues.
  • Parking

    Parking is available nearby. Visit https://nycparkingauthority.com/one-world-trade-center-parking-guide/
  • Passenger Loading Zone

    Access-a-Ride users can use the AAR bus stop at the front entry of PAC NYC for more convenient pick-ups and drop-offs.
  • Restroom

    Accessible restrooms are located on the 2nd and 3rd level of the building, accessible via elevator from the ground and the main 2nd level lobby. Three ADA Single use restrooms (Large enough for companion assistance) are located on the 2nd level. Two ADA Single use restrooms (Large enough for companion assistance) and 4 wheelchair accessible toilets are located on the 3rd level.
  • Seating

    All theaters have wheelchair- and scooter-accessible locations where patrons can remain in their wheelchairs or transfer to theater seats. Patrons who cannot or do not wish to transfer from their wheelchairs to a theater seat should request/purchase wheelchair-accessible locations when ordering tickets. Seats with removable armrests are available in all venues.
  • Visual Assistance

    Audio description is scheduled for select PAC NYC events throughout the year. Patrons who wish to listen to the description must pick up a headset. Headsets are distributed free-of-charge on a first-come, first-served basis from the Ticketing and Information Desk. Touch tours are made available when possible in conjunction with audio described performances. Large print and braille Playbills are available.
  • Wheelchair Info

    All theaters have wheelchair- and scooter-accessible locations where patrons can remain in their wheelchairs or transfer to theater seats. Patrons who cannot or do not wish to transfer from their wheelchairs to a theater seat should request/purchase wheelchair-accessible locations when ordering tickets. For assistance selecting accessible seats or for more information about accessibility for a person with a disability, please contact 212-266-3010 or accessibility@pacnyc.org.
